[Melba, Nellie. (1861–1931) & Calvé, Emma. (1858–1942) & Bonci, Alessandro. (1870–1940)]. Original 1903 Royal Opera Gala Program, Printed on Silk. Original souvenir program, printed on silk with a tasseled border, from a 1903 royal command performance of the Royal Opera given in honor of the visit of the President of the French Republic. The performance, on July 7, 1903, starred Nellie Melba, Emma Calvé, and Alessandro Bonci in a scene from Rigoletto and the second acts of Carmen and Romeo et Juliette. The program features a large decorative border with portraits of King Edward VII and Queen Alexandra. Large central folding crease and some slight wrinkling (which could likely be removed); overall in fine condition. 12.5 x 16.5 inches (31.5 x 42 cm).
